What is Medicare Part-D Claims

The Medicare Part-D Prescription Drug Claims Form is a medical billing document used by Medicare beneficiaries to request reimbursement for prescription drugs not purchased at a network pharmacy.

Comprehensive Guide to Medicare Part-D Claims

What is the Medicare Part-D Prescription Drug Claims Form?

The Medicare Part-D Prescription Drug Claims Form is a critical document for Medicare beneficiaries seeking reimbursement for prescription drugs purchased outside of approved pharmacy networks. This form is essential for accessing financial support for out-of-pocket medication costs.
This form encompasses key terms such as reimbursement, which refers to the process by which beneficiaries receive money back for their expenses. Understanding pharmacy networks is also crucial since it determines eligibility and process for submitting claims.
To fill out the form correctly, users must provide necessary details, including medication names, dispense dates, prescriber information, and the amount paid. Ensuring accurate completion is vital for successful claims.

How to fill out the Medicare Part-D Claims

  1. 1.
    Open pdfFiller and search for 'Medicare Part-D Prescription Drug Claims Form' in the template library.
  2. 2.
    Once the form is open, navigate through the fillable fields to enter your information accurately.
  3. 3.
    Gather required details before you begin, including prescription receipts, medication names, dispense dates, amounts paid, and prescriber information.
  4. 4.
    Fill in the medication fields by entering the National Drug Code (NDC), strength, dosage, quantity, and days' supply as instructed in each column.
  5. 5.
    Provide the prescriber's name and their National Provider Identification number (NPI) in the designated fields.
  6. 6.
    After filling out all necessary sections, carefully review the form for any missing or incorrect information.
  7. 7.
    Use the options provided by pdfFiller to electronically sign the document, ensuring that it is signed by you or your pharmacist/physician as required.
  8. 8.
    Once reviewed and signed, save the form to your pdfFiller account or download it in your preferred format.
  9. 9.
    If necessary, submit the completed form electronically via pdfFiller or print it out for mailing.

Medicare beneficiaries who need reimbursement for prescription drugs not purchased through a Medicare network pharmacy are eligible to use this form. This includes individuals who have incurred costs for medications directly from a pharmacy.
You should include all receipts for the medications you are claiming. Each receipt should clearly show the medication name, dispense date, and amount paid. Missing receipts can delay processing or result in denial of the claim.
The completed form can either be submitted electronically through pdfFiller or printed out for postal submission. Ensure to follow the submission guidelines provided by your Medicare plan.
Yes, there are typically deadlines for submitting claims to receive reimbursement. Generally, you should submit your claims as soon as possible after incurring costs, ideally within 90 days of the purchase.
Ensure that all fields are completed accurately, particularly medication details and prescriber information. Missing required information or incorrect coding can lead to delays. Always double-check your submission before finalizing.
Processing times can vary, but claims typically take several weeks to process. You should expect to hear back regarding your claim status, so keep records of your submissions for reference.
If your claim is denied, review the denial notice for reasons. You may need to provide additional documentation or appeal the decision through your Medicare provider. Contact customer service for assistance if needed.
